Chapter 2. Setup and Operation
2.1 Preliminary Setup (cont.)
7.
Connect the nitrogen supply to the MG-101 inlet fitting via the stainless steel pressure regulator using, 1/4” OD
stainless steel tubing (see
below).
Note:
Swagelok
®
fittings are preferred throughout the installation.
8.
Connect the calibration chamber to the MG-101 outlet fitting, using 1/4” OD SS tubing. Then, leak test the
connection.
Note:
GE Sensing
Sample Cell #2830
is the preferred calibration chamber for M2 Type probes
9.
At the outlet of the calibration chamber, connect at least 5 ft (1.5 m) of 1/4” OD tubing as a vent to atmosphere.
The tubing may be coiled to save space.
10.
Insert the sensor to be calibrated into the calibration chamber and tighten it sufficiently to ensure a leak-proof seal,
but be careful not to over-tighten the sensor.
